Registered Nurse - Emergency | Mackay Base Hospital, Queensland About the Role: Mackay Base Hospital's Emergency Department (ED) is a Level 4 clinical service capability, managing both adult and paediatric patients. The department features 2 Resuscitation/Trauma bays, 3 High Dependency (HDU) bays, 12 acute bed spaces, 5 paediatric bays, 12 fast track spaces, 16 short stay beds, 2 mental health bays, and 1 isolation HDU bay. The ED sees over 150 patients per day, offering a fast-paced and challenging environment for experienced emergency nurses.
